Hi Carol, I have been off gleevec for over 6 years now. (Was on it for 2 yrs, 3 mos.) My numbers are slowly climbing. I have tried sprycel and tasigna and had problems with both. Now the only remaining one left to try is bosutinib. I have a tendency to have brain bleeds, which can certainly be fatal. One big stroke in 2010 and now kind of waiting before taking anything due to that. If your doc monitors your numbers there is no huge risk to going off for a vacation, if you are undetectable at present. I am hoping for that vaccination to come into reality that may be a better answer for me than meds. Praying for your continued remission and all to go well for you.

On Sunday, November 24, 2013 10:06:43 AM UTC-6, [email protected] wrote: Hi to all, haven't posted in a long time seem to need some advice now...Was on Gleevec for 10 years..switched to sprycel due to kidney issues...was on sprycel for 2 years when I developed pleural effusions. .I have had 4 drained and now have a chest tube, which is miserable as I still work...I see my oncologist tomorrow and have decided to go off sprycel...due to other reasons I cannot take Tasignia, so will probably go back to Gleevec....here is my dilema...I would like to take a chemo break...how long is safe and how many have tried this? Also, I now have to sign up for medicare...has anyone found a medigap plan that will cover these drugs....thanks so much for all the support that is given on this site...amazing people with amazing faith and strength..
